Pakistan achieved a significant milestone in rice exports
In 2024, Pakistan achieved a significant milestone in rice exports, with a 25% increase in shipments to Saudi Arabia, reaching $4 billion.
The exceptional quality of Pakistani rice has gained immense popularity among Saudi consumers, boosting demand. Optimistic exporters anticipate rice exports will grow to $4.5 billion by 2025.
The Chairman of the Saudi-Pakistani Business Council lauded the premium quality of Pakistani rice, highlighting its rising status in the Saudi market. Efforts by the Special Investment Facilitation Council (SIFC) have played a crucial role in this success.
As per SIFC official Shahjehan Malik, Pakistan aims to hit a $5 billion export target in the next fiscal year, focusing on advanced research into seeds and the promotion of standardized agricultural practices. Pakistan’s Basmati rice continues to strengthen its position as a premium product in global markets.
